Unlocking the Ultimate Generator for Your Pop-Up Camper: A Comprehensive Review

When embarking on the great adventure of camping with a pop-up camper,ensuring a reliable power source is essential for a comfortable and enjoyable experience.

A generator tailored to the specific needs of your pop-up camper can make all the difference.

Here,we delve into the essential features and considerations that will guide you in unlocking the best generator for your pop-up camper.

1. Power Requirements:

The first step in selecting the ideal generator is understanding the power requirements of your pop-up camper.

Take into account the appliances and devices you intend to use,such as lights,refrigerator,heating or cooling systems,and electronic gadgets.

Choose a generator with adequate wattage to power these devices without overloading the system.

2. Size and Portability:

Pop-up campers are designed for convenience and mobility,and your generator should follow suit.

Compact and lightweight models with ergonomic handles make transportation easy,allowing you to move the generator effortlessly to your preferred camping spot.

3. Fuel Efficiency:

Fuel efficiency becomes crucial when camping,particularly if you’re exploring off-grid locations.

Look for generators with advanced features such as inverter technology,which adjusts the engine speed based on the required load,improving fuel efficiency.

Not only does this extend the run time,but it also minimizes fuel consumption.

4. Noise Level:

One of the joys of camping is the tranquility of nature.

Steer clear of a loud generator that may disrupt the peace and quiet of your surroundings.

Look for generators with low decibel ratings to guarantee a quiet and serene camping experience.

Modern generators often come equipped with noise reduction features,making them an ideal choice for campers seeking tranquility.

5. Compatibility with Camper Electronics:

Pop-up campers commonly feature electronic components like sensitive gadgets and entertainment systems.

Ensure the generator you choose provides clean and stable power,preventing any damage to your camper’s electronics.

For this purpose,inverter generators are particularly well-suited,delivering a smooth and consistent power output.

6. Run Time and Tank Capacity:

Consider the generator’s run time on a full tank of fuel,as this directly impacts your camping experience.

Opt for generators with longer run times,requiring less frequent refueling and ensuring uninterrupted power throughout your camping adventure.

Additionally,a larger fuel tank capacity can be advantageous,especially if you’re camping in remote locations where fuel availability might be limited.

7. Durability and Weather Resistance:

Campers often face unpredictable weather conditions.

Therefore,investing in a generator with a durable build and weather-resistant features is wise.

Opt for models with robust enclosures and components capable of withstanding exposure to the elements,ensuring your generator continues to perform reliably in various outdoor conditions.
